在 linux 上可以同时运行的 unix donaim 套接字的最大数量

Maximum number of unix donaim socket that can run in the same time on linux

提问人:Anis 提问时间:11/10/2023 更新时间:11/10/2023 访问量:58

问:

除了我们可以更改的文件描述符限制之外,linux 可以并行管理的最大 unix 域套接字数量是多少? 某些操作系统具有限制 https://www.ibm.com/docs/en/ztpf/1.1.0.15?topic=considerations-unix-domain-sockets

我收到太多打开的文件操作系统错误。我没有达到 NOFILE 限制。

linux 内核 libc libc++

评论

0赞 John Bollinger 11/10/2023
我不知道 Linux 有明确的限制,但我没有找到任何明确否认限制的文档。
0赞 Armali 11/10/2023
@Anis – 我想知道为什么在一个进程中需要这么多套接字,因为一对多通信可以通过一个套接字进行。
1赞 Anis 11/10/2023
@Armali我处理遗留代码时,我在服务器中使用一个SOCK_DGRAM来连接另一个。我似乎随机达到了一个隐藏的极限。
0赞 Armali 11/10/2023
您如何检查在故障点打开了多少个文件?
0赞 Anis 11/10/2023
我们正在跟踪主机上打开的 FD 的数量,它是 50K,而进程的最大设置是 200K

答: 暂无答案